Francois Jacob 17 June 1920 – 19 April 2013 was a French biologist who together with Jacques Monod originated the idea that control of enzyme levels in all cells occurs through regulation of transcription. He shared the 1965 Nobel Prize in Medicine with Jacques Monod and Andre Lwoff. – obituary: Nature Volume: 497 Page: 440 23 May 2013. ISBN: 0394472462 Pantheon Books, (1973). hardcover books
